Can Indians Start a Business in Bahrain?

Yes, Indian citizens can legally establish a business in Bahrain. Many business sectors allow 100% foreign ownership, enabling entrepreneurs to maintain full control of their companies without requiring a local partner for eligible activities. Depending on your chosen business activity, you may need to obtain specific licenses or approvals before beginning operations.

Choose the Right Business Structure

Selecting the appropriate legal structure is one of the first and most important decisions. Bahrain offers several company structures designed to meet different business needs.

Limited Liability Company (LLC)

An LLC is the most common choice for foreign investors. It provides limited liability protection and is suitable for trading, consulting, service-based businesses, and commercial activities.

Single Person Company (SPC)

If you want to operate your business as the sole owner, an SPC allows you to establish a separate legal entity while retaining complete ownership.

Branch Office

Businesses already operating in India can expand into Bahrain by opening a branch office. This option allows the parent company to conduct business in Bahrain under its existing corporate identity.

Step-by-Step Process to Start a Business in Bahrain from India

The registration process is straightforward when you prepare the necessary documents and follow the required legal procedures.

Step 1: Select Your Business Activity

Choose the business activities your company will perform. The selected activity determines the type of commercial license and any regulatory approvals required.

Step 2: Reserve Your Company Name

Select a unique company name that complies with Bahrain's business naming guidelines. The name must be approved before registration continues.

Step 3: Prepare the Required Documents

Gather the necessary documents, including passport copies of shareholders, proof of address, company information, and any additional paperwork required for your chosen business activity.

Step 4: Register Your Company

Submit the incorporation application along with the required documents to the relevant authority. Once approved, your company will be officially registered.

Step 5: Obtain Business Licenses

Depending on your industry, you may need commercial licenses or sector-specific approvals before starting operations.

Step 6: Open a Corporate Bank Account

A corporate bank account is essential for managing business transactions. Bahrain has a well-developed banking sector that supports both local and international businesses.

Documents Required

The exact documentation depends on your business activity and legal structure. However, most Indian entrepreneurs will need valid passports, proof of residential address, shareholder details, company name options, business activity information, and incorporation documents. Some regulated industries may require additional approvals from government authorities.
